Kinds Of Mitsubishi Keys
Mitsubishi cars utilize numerous kinds of keys, depending on the year, model, and trim. Understanding the types can help you determine which replacement alternative you'll require:
Key Types OverviewKey TypeDescriptionYear ModelsTraditional KeyA basic mechanical key that unlocks the doors.Older Mitsubishi models, such as the Mitsubishi Replacement Key Fob Galant (pre-2004)Transponder KeyA key which contains a chip programmed to start the automobile.Most Mitsubishi models (2004-present)Smart KeyA keyless entry system that enables push-start ignitions.More recent models such as Mitsubishi Outlander (2016 and more recent)Key FobA remote device that can lock/unlock doors and start the vehicle wirelessly.Common in lots of Mitsubishi vehicles from 2004 onwardsPicking the Right Replacement Key
When it concerns replacing your Mitsubishi key, there are several aspects to consider. You need to recognize the type of key your Mitsubishi Car Key design uses, as this will determine the replacement procedure.
Replacement Options
Car dealership Replacement: The safest and most dependable alternative for key replacement is through a licensed Mitsubishi dealership. However, this choice can be expensive and may need evidence of ownership.
Automotive Locksmiths: Many locksmith professionals are geared up to deal with Mitsubishi keys, particularly transponder keys and clever keys. They can frequently offer a more economical service and a quicker turnaround.
Online Retailers: For standard keys, you might find aftermarket choices on websites such as Amazon or eBay. However, be careful, as these keys will need cutting to match your locks.
Mobile Services: Mobile locksmiths can concern your location, making it convenient for those who can not take a trip to a dealership or shop. Make certain they're familiar with Mitsubishi automobiles to ensure accuracy in shows keys.
The Replacement Process
The procedure of getting a replacement key for your Mitsubishi can differ based upon the key type. Below is a detailed breakdown of what the replacement procedure usually includes.
Traditional Key ReplacementCheck out a Locksmith or Automotive Store: No shows is required.Offer Your Key's Code: If you do not have a key, the locksmith professional may need to access your lorry's lock code (often found in the owner's manual).Cut the New Key: The locksmith professional will cut a new key utilizing the code.Transponder Key ReplacementLocate Your Vehicle Information: Provide your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and show ownership (this might include ID or registration).Check out a Locksmith or Dealer: The key will require programming post-cutting.Key Programming: The locksmith professional or dealership will program the new transponder key to your particular automobile.Smart Key ReplacementPick Your Replacement Mitsubishi Car Keys Source: Going to a dealership is typically the best option for wise keys due to their complexity.Supply Proof of Ownership: Ensuring you have the necessary documentation is essential.Program the New Key: This requires specialized devices that dealers or skilled locksmith professionals generally have.Expenses of Replacement
The cost of replacing a Mitsubishi key can substantially differ depending upon the key type and the replacement technique. Here's a cost introduction:
Estimated Replacement CostsKey TypeDealer Price EstimateLocksmith Professional Price EstimateOnline Price EstimateTraditional Key₤ 50 - ₤ 100₤ 30 - ₤ 60₤ 10 - ₤ 30Transponder Key₤ 100 - ₤ 300₤ 75 - ₤ 150N/ASmart Key₤ 250 - ₤ 500₤ 200 - ₤ 400N/AFrequently asked question SectionQ1: Is it possible to replace a lost key without the initial?

Q2: Can I program a new key myself?
Programs can be complicated, especially for transponder and clever keys. It's usually recommended to consult a professional to guarantee it's done properly.
Q3: How long does the replacement procedure take?
The time differs based on the key type and where you go. Traditional key replacements might take just minutes, while smart key replacements could use up to a few hours.
Q4: Are all Mitsubishi keys the very same?
No, Mitsubishi keys are model-specific. Guarantee you get the correct key for your automobile design and year.
Q5: What should I do if my key breaks or fails to work?
If your key breaks, avoid utilizing excessive force to turn it. Rather, get in touch with a professional locksmith professional or dealership for a complete replacement.
